Which president will you honor Monday, President's Day? On Monday, offices of the state and federal government will be closed along with many local municipal offices. Banks in Pennsylvania have the option of closing, while retailers are sure to be open, drumming up business with sale specials for "Presidents' Day." Just which of the 42 men who have been elected to the nation's highest office are being honored on this annual holiday, observed on the third Monday of February? For the federal legislators who created Monday's holiday--or, at least, placed it where it currently falls on the calendar--George Washington definitely ranks an uncontested first. Although it has popularly become known as "Presidents' Day," as far as the U.S. government is concerned, the third Monday in February has been set aside as an observance solely of "Washington's Birthday."
